馬振寰 荊麗麗
摘要:本文對(duì)現(xiàn)有高校實(shí)驗(yàn)室的現(xiàn)狀展開(kāi)分析,結(jié)合集寧師范學(xué)院的現(xiàn)有情況,利用組態(tài)軟件MCGS的靈活性,操作界面安全易操作的等特點(diǎn),對(duì)當(dāng)前實(shí)驗(yàn)室的監(jiān)控系統(tǒng)提出了行之有效的設(shè)計(jì)思路,并給出符合實(shí)際需求的解決方法。
關(guān)鍵詞:PLC;MCGS;三層電梯
中圖分類(lèi)號(hào):G642.0 文獻(xiàn)標(biāo)志碼:A 文章編號(hào):1674-9324(2017)05-0265-02
一、前言
實(shí)驗(yàn)室是高等院校進(jìn)行教學(xué)和科學(xué)研究活動(dòng)的重要場(chǎng)所,存放有眾多種類(lèi)的儀器設(shè)備,也有易燃、易爆、劇毒等危險(xiǎn)性物品,加之使用頻繁、人員集中且流動(dòng)性大,這往往會(huì)給學(xué)校帶來(lái)巨大的財(cái)產(chǎn)損失,有時(shí)甚至是人員的傷亡。實(shí)際調(diào)研中發(fā)現(xiàn)大部分學(xué)校的實(shí)驗(yàn)室沒(méi)有監(jiān)控系統(tǒng),存在很大的安全隱患。為了提高實(shí)驗(yàn)室安全系數(shù)、設(shè)備使用壽命以及節(jié)約能源,本文提出了實(shí)驗(yàn)室監(jiān)控系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n),著重介紹基于MCGS的實(shí)驗(yàn)室電梯監(jiān)控系統(tǒng),主要是采用PLC硬件與組態(tài)軟件MCGS的有機(jī)結(jié)合,實(shí)現(xiàn)三層電梯的設(shè)計(jì)與監(jiān)控。
二、PLC與MCGS介紹
(一)PLC介紹
可編程控制器(PLC)是以微處理器為基礎(chǔ)的通用工業(yè)控制裝置。實(shí)際是一種工業(yè)控制計(jì)算機(jī),它的硬件結(jié)構(gòu)與一般微機(jī)控制系統(tǒng)相似??删幊炭刂破髦饕蒀PU(中央處理單元)、存儲(chǔ)器(RAM、ROM和EEPROM)、輸入/輸出模塊(簡(jiǎn)稱(chēng)I/O模塊)、編程器和電源五大部分組成。本文采用西門(mén)子公司的S7-200PLC進(jìn)行設(shè)計(jì)。
(二)MCGS介紹
它是以監(jiān)測(cè)控制計(jì)算機(jī)為主體,加上檢測(cè)裝置、執(zhí)行機(jī)構(gòu)與被監(jiān)測(cè)控制的對(duì)象(生產(chǎn)過(guò)程)共同構(gòu)成的整體。而組態(tài)軟件具有動(dòng)畫(huà)顯示、流程控制、數(shù)據(jù)采集、設(shè)備控制與輸出、工程報(bào)表、數(shù)據(jù)與曲線等強(qiáng)大功能。
三、基于MCGS的實(shí)驗(yàn)室監(jiān)控系統(tǒng)開(kāi)發(fā)的設(shè)計(jì)思路
(一)三層電梯模擬控制的PLC程序設(shè)計(jì)
1.I/O分配。對(duì)所有的輸入輸出變量進(jìn)行賦值,并對(duì)其分配地址。
2.根據(jù)控制要求編寫(xiě)PLC程序梯形圖程序。
3.設(shè)置PG/PC接口,在PLC中的“接口分配參數(shù)”處選擇“PC/PPI cable(PPI)”,然后再打?qū)傩源翱冢诒镜剡B接處下拉,選中“COM1”。
(二)監(jiān)控系統(tǒng)的MCGS設(shè)計(jì)
1.利用組態(tài)軟件中的“工具箱”及其中的常用圖符進(jìn)行繪圖。
2.定義數(shù)據(jù)變量。
3.設(shè)定循環(huán)策略。
在MCGS組態(tài)軟件“運(yùn)行策略”窗口中,打開(kāi)“循環(huán)策略”之后,打開(kāi)“策略屬性設(shè)置”,在“循環(huán)時(shí)間”位置,將時(shí)間修改為100ms,單擊“確定”。之后在當(dāng)前界面空白處,鼠標(biāo)右鍵,點(diǎn)擊“新增策略行”,然后鼠標(biāo)右鍵打開(kāi)“策略工具箱”,將“腳本程序”拖拽到策略行后面方塊出。
4.根據(jù)要求編寫(xiě)調(diào)試腳本程序。
(三)PLC和MCGS的連接
基于西門(mén)子可編程控制器和MCGS動(dòng)態(tài)組態(tài)軟件的三層電梯控制系統(tǒng),就是對(duì)三層電梯的編程設(shè)計(jì)與動(dòng)態(tài)仿真的結(jié)合。此次設(shè)計(jì),利用MCGS組態(tài)軟件對(duì)元件與數(shù)據(jù)變量的連接,利用相應(yīng)的三層電梯腳本,控制電梯轎廂運(yùn)行及樓層門(mén)開(kāi)關(guān)的動(dòng)態(tài)仿真。然后利用S7-200PLC編入的三層電梯程序經(jīng)過(guò)正確調(diào)試后,把PLC200-PPI添加到MCGS的設(shè)備窗口中,由PLC的輸入控制MCGS的輸出,實(shí)現(xiàn)對(duì)三層電梯的全面監(jiān)控。
設(shè)備窗口的創(chuàng)建及連接:
第一步:找到組態(tài)軟件中的設(shè)備窗口,鼠標(biāo)雙擊打開(kāi)。
第二步:在設(shè)備工具箱中找到“通用串口父設(shè)備”和“西門(mén)子_S7200PPI”分別添加在設(shè)備窗口中。
第三步:分別設(shè)置“通用串口父設(shè)備”和“西門(mén)子_S7200PPI”的設(shè)備屬性。
第四步:完成以上設(shè)置后,進(jìn)入PLC編程界面,進(jìn)行與實(shí)驗(yàn)箱通信連接。
第五步:PLC編程界面下,下載調(diào)試PLC程序。
第六步:程序調(diào)試成功后,回到MCGS組態(tài)軟件的界面中,進(jìn)行MCGS與PLC連接。
第七步:在MCGS組態(tài)軟件界面下,運(yùn)行調(diào)試仿真,并實(shí)現(xiàn)系統(tǒng)的狀態(tài)監(jiān)控。
基于MCGS的實(shí)驗(yàn)室監(jiān)控實(shí)現(xiàn)了數(shù)字化、遠(yuǎn)程化的監(jiān)控,并能夠及時(shí)發(fā)現(xiàn)監(jiān)控環(huán)境中的異常情況,且以最快和最佳的方式發(fā)出警報(bào)和提供有用信息,從而能夠更加有效地協(xié)助安全人員處理危機(jī),并最大限度地降低誤報(bào)和漏報(bào)現(xiàn)象。
參考文獻(xiàn):
[1]廖常初.S7-200PLC編程及應(yīng)用(第2版)[M].北京:機(jī)械工業(yè)出版社,2013.
[2]李紅萍.工控組態(tài)技術(shù)應(yīng)用——MCGS[M].西安:西安電子科技大學(xué)出版社,2013.
[3]李江全.組態(tài)軟件MCGS從入門(mén)到監(jiān)控35例[M].北京:電子工業(yè)出版社,2015.
[4]孫婷荃,徐金光.關(guān)于完善實(shí)驗(yàn)室安全管理體制的幾點(diǎn)思考[J].湖北師范學(xué)院學(xué)報(bào)(自然科學(xué)版),2007,27(3):112-114.
[5]秧耕,何喬治,何峰峰.電梯基本原理及安裝維修全書(shū)[M].北京:機(jī)械工業(yè)出版社,2001.